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court examined a dispute arising from a delayed construction project awarded to the appellant by the respondent, All India Radio. The arbitral award, which granted loss of profit to the appellant, was challenged under Section 34 of the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996, and set aside by the High Court. The appellate court upheld the High Court's decision, affirming that the arbitral tribunal's award was rightly annulled. The Court's decision underscores the importance of adherence to procedural and substantive standards in arbitration awards.
